Output 8056768460c661bab6e24a00689eca39fdcd48394c5dc584aed2e22ac3cfaa7b:0

value
537780
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87b6c7b055c993cbe6825d7e0771926074d0c80c OP_EQUALVERIFY OP_CHECKSIG
address
1DNbBgEszEdfKfeWnhf7VWThqn6Rm789F4
transaction
8056768460c661bab6e24a00689eca39fdcd48394c5dc584aed2e22ac3cfaa7b
spent
true